High School Football: Mason City’s undefeated season stopped cold by Covid-19

MASON CITY – For once, in a long time, it is not another football team dealing a blow to the Mason City Mohawks, it is Covid-19 this time, as its season is suspended due to exposure by coaches to the dreaded virus.

Mason City was due to play Fort Dodge this Friday in a home contest, and the two rivals have battled on the gridiron every year since 1923, but this year, the game is cancelled. It was announced that some football coaches for the Mohawks have been exposed to Covid-19 and therefore, this weeks game and next week’s against Gilbert are cancelled.

In Tuesday’s announcement, the Mason City School District said (1) All coaches exposed are following quarantine protocols set by public health; (2) To our knowledge no varsity players exposed; (3) Important for players to continue to monitor their health daily; (4) Football questions should be directed to coaches; and (5) COVID related questions should be directed to the Superintendent’s office – 641-450-5001.

Mason City is 1-0 on the season and rolling along after dismantling the hapless Marshalltown Bobcats last week, 28-0.
